Common Issues on the 2016 Yamaha YZ450F

Overview

The 2016 Yamaha YZ450F is a high-performance dirt bike designed primarily for motocross riding. Known for its powerful engine and agile handling, it has garnered a reputation for reliability and competitive performance on the track.

Common Mechanical Problems & Known Weak Points

Engine & Power Delivery

Some riders report issues with engine stalling or hesitation during acceleration. This can be caused by a dirty air filter or fuel system problems. Regular cleaning of the air filter and ensuring the fuel system is free of debris can help mitigate these issues.

Fueling or Intake Issues

Fuel delivery problems may arise, leading to poor throttle response. Symptoms include rough idling or difficulty starting. This often occurs due to clogged fuel injectors. Cleaning or replacing the injectors can resolve this issue.

Suspension Problems

Some owners experience issues with the front fork seals leaking. This can lead to reduced suspension performance. Regular inspection and timely replacement of seals can prevent further damage.

Electrical or Starting Issues

Starting problems may occur, often linked to a weak battery or faulty starter relay. Symptoms include the bike not cranking or intermittent starting. Checking the battery condition and replacing the starter relay if necessary can improve reliability.

Transmission or Clutch Concerns

Clutch slippage is a common complaint, particularly under heavy load. This can be due to worn clutch plates. Regular inspection and replacement of the clutch plates can ensure smooth operation.

Brakes or Handling

Some riders report a spongy brake feel, which can be caused by air in the brake lines. Bleeding the brake system can restore proper brake function.

Chassis, Plastics, or Hardware Weak Points

Cracks in the plastic bodywork are not uncommon, especially after a few hard rides. Using protective guards and being mindful of impacts can help prolong the life of the plastics.

Preventative Upgrades & Reliability Improvements

Common preventative upgrades include installing an aftermarket air filter for better airflow and performance. Regular maintenance, such as oil changes and chain lubrication, can significantly extend the bike's longevity and reliability.

Ownership & Maintenance Tips

  • Check and clean the air filter regularly.
  • Inspect the brake system and bleed as needed.
  • Monitor the clutch for signs of wear.
  • Keep the chain lubricated and adjusted.
  • Perform regular oil changes to maintain engine health.
